Delayed eclampsia >48 hours following delivery, up to 4 weeks postpartum, accounts for approximately 15% of cases of eclampsia. 63% had no antepartum hypertensive diagnosis. WebPre-eclampsia also doubles the risk of death of the baby around the time of birth. Usually there are no symptoms in pre-eclampsia and it is detected by routine screening. When symptoms of pre-eclampsia occur the most common are headache, visual disturbance (often "flashing lights"), vomiting, pain over the stomach, and swelling . incorporated association constitution qld https://welcomehomenutrition.com

WebJul 21, 2012 · The symptoms of pre-eclampsia include high blood pressure, protein in urine and fluid retention and affects almost 10% of pregnancies after 20 weeks. Left untreated, the condition can cause a range of problems such as growth restriction in babies and even foetal and maternal mortality. There is no known cause of the condition.
